Stephen Curry
When you see the No. 30 jersey, you can’t help but think of Warriors star Stephen Curry, who just broke the all-time record for three-pointers yesterday. When asked by reporters why he chose the No. 30 jersey, Curry said, “Wearing the No. 30 jersey is a tribute to my father, that’s the jersey number he used to wear, and I think that’s a number worth celebrating.” The long wave pushed the previous wave, when the record-breaking ball was handed to the old Curry, I think this legacy has reached its peak.

Donovan Er
Mitchell has been nothing but phenomenal this season, and the young guard, who was drafted 13th overall in the first round, 25 years old from the Jazz is playing the role of a superstar of the team. When asked about Mitchell’s choice of the No. 45 jersey, he said baseball and basketball were two sports he grew up with, and that the god of basketball, Michael Jordan, went to play baseball for a while after his first retirement wearing the No. 45 jersey. When he returned to the game for the second time, he also wore No. 45 for a while. Mitchell, who is obsessed with these two sports, chose the No. 45 jersey with his admiration for the basketball gods.

Chris Paul
Banana boat four brothers also gradually came to the end of their careers, with Wade’s retirement, let us see some superstars are also slowly getting older. Paul, who touched the floor of the Western Conference last year, made fans lament that youth has just passed and CP3 is getting old. The reason why Paul chose number three is simple, his father and brother’s initials are C and P. Father is CP1, brother is CP2, and Chris Paul naturally became CP3. The jersey. Yannis Adetokounmpo
Last season’s NBA championship FMVP, Alphabet, is still going strong in the new season. Explosive physical quality. Let him show a strong dominance in the NBA where the long man is like a forest. So far this season, the average score of 27 points per game is also ranked second in the league. The reason Alphabet chose #34 was solely because of his family, his mother was born in 1963 and his father was born in 1964. Combining 3 and 4 together, the Greek monster’s No. 34 jersey was born. It’s worth mentioning that Alphabet’s older brother, Thanassis Adetokunbo’s jersey is number 43. The brothers’ gratitude to their parents is expressed through their jerseys.

James Harden
The bearded Harden, whose form has slumped badly in the new season, seems to be picking up a bit lately. Harden and Durant are dragging the team forward and steadily in away from the top spot in the East, which is obviously difficult. With Irving’s return undetermined, what does this team’s championship run look like? The reason Harden chose the No. 13 jersey is a bit of an oops. He had to choose a jersey number his freshman year, but there were only No. 13 and No. 52 left, so he simply chose No. 13 directly.
